Web29 de abr. de 2024 · At a constant pressure and amount of gas, how are temperature and volume related? A. directly B. inversely C. not related See answer Advertisement Advertisement kegrant42 kegrant42 The volume is directly proportional to the absolute temperature so the answer is A.
